/**
* Provides various <code>PingIterator</code>
* implementations for the <code>PingManager</code>.
*/
class PingIteratorFactory {
private PingIteratorFactory() {
}
/**
* A ContactPinger sends ping requests to a Set of Contacts
*/
static class ContactPinger implements PingIterator {
final Collection<? extends Contact> nodes;
final Iterator<? extends Contact> it;
public ContactPinger(Contact node) {
this(Collections.singleton(node));
}
public ContactPinger(Set<? extends Contact> nodes) {
if (nodes == null) {
throw new NullPointerException("Set<Contact> is null");
}
for (Contact c : nodes) {
if (c == null) {
throw new NullPointerException("Contact is null");
}
}
this.nodes = nodes;
this.it = nodes.iterator();
}
public boolean hasNext() {
return it.hasNext();
}
public boolean pingNext(Context context, PingResponseHandler responseHandler)
throws IOException {
Contact node = it.next();
KUID nodeId = node.getNodeID();
SocketAddress dst = node.getContactAddress();
RequestMessage request = context.getMessageHelper().createPingRequest(dst);
return context.getMessageDispatcher().send(nodeId, dst, request, responseHandler);
}
@Override
public String toString() {
return "ContactPinger: " + nodes;
}
}
/**
* Sends collision ping requests to a Set of <code>Contact</code>s.
*/
static class CollisionPinger extends ContactPinger {
private final Contact sender;
public CollisionPinger(Context context, Contact sender, Contact node) {
this(context, sender, Collections.singleton(node));
}
public CollisionPinger(Context context, Contact sender,
Set<? extends Contact> nodes) {
super(nodes);
if (ContextSettings.ASSERT_COLLISION_PING.getValue()) {
assertCollisionPing(context, sender, nodes);
}
this.sender = sender;
}
private void assertCollisionPing(Context context, Contact sender,
Set<? extends Contact> nodes) {
KUID localId = context.getLocalNodeID();
if (!ContactUtils.isCollisionPingSender(localId, sender)) {
throw new IllegalArgumentException(sender
+ " is not a valid collision ping Contact");
}
for (Contact node : nodes) {
if (!localId.equals(node.getNodeID())) {
throw new IllegalArgumentException(node
+ " must have the same ID as the local Node ID: " + localId);
}
}
}
@Override
public boolean pingNext(Context context, PingResponseHandler responseHandler)
throws IOException {
Contact node = it.next();
KUID nodeId = node.getNodeID();
SocketAddress dst = node.getContactAddress();
// Send a collision test ping instead of a regular ping
RequestMessage request = context.getMessageFactory().createPingRequest(sender, dst);
return context.getMessageDispatcher().send(nodeId, dst, request, responseHandler);
}
@Override
public String toString() {
return "CollisionPinger: " + sender;
}
}
